  1. Heartland HJ1000

    Heartland

    By Gabriel Jason Dean.

    Product Code: HJ1000

    • Drama
    • College | Community | Professional
    • 2m., 1w.

      Livestream and Record & Stream Rights Available

    • 100 min.
    Dr. Harold Banks is a retired professor of comparative literature and Afghan Studies, waiting for Geetee, his adopted daughter, to return from teaching in Afghanistan, her native country. When Nazrullah, an Afghan refugee, suddenly arrives on his Nebraska doorstep, the two men become unlikely roommates. Heartland is the story of a father, his determined daughter, and a journey toward mercy. Learn More

  3. Proprioception PN2000

    Proprioception

    By Marilyn Millstone.

    Product Code: PN2000

    • Drama
    • College | Community | Professional
    • 2m., 2w.
    • 120 min.
    Kylie is a young prima ballerina with a torn ACL and a chip on her shoulder. Esther is an elderly widowed Holocaust survivor estranged from her only child. Both are patients of renowned Black physical therapist Mike Sheffield. When Sheffield decides that the two women should share appointments, attachments form, conflicts erupt, secrets surface and lives unravel. A play about how we heal … and how we don’t. Learn More

  5. Gretel! The Musical GE1000

    Gretel! The Musical

    Book by Jason Tremblay and Suzan Zeder. Music by Jenn Hartmann Luck. Lyrics by Jenn Hartmann Luck, Suzan Zeder and Jason Tremblay. Cello Arrangements by Nora Karakousoglou.

    Product Code: GE1000

    • Comedy | Drama
    • Elementary School | Middle School | High School | College | Community | Professional | TYA
    • 1 to 4m., 2 to 6w.

      Livestream and Record & Stream Rights Available

    • 75 min.
    Before there was Hansel, there was Gretel! Based on the Russian origin story, this musical focuses on the girls and women at the center of Gretel’s quest to fetch the skull of undying light from Baba Yaga, one of the most fascinating witches of all time. On her journey, Gretel discovers the positive power of her anger, the comfort of her compassion, the gift of her grief, and the truth of her own birthright, as she teaches herself how to survive.   6. Yasmina's Necklace Cover Y36000

    Yasmina's Necklace

    By Rohina Malik.

    Product Code: Y36000

    • Comedy | Drama
    • College | Community | Professional
    • 5m., 2w.

      Livestream and Record & Stream Rights Available

    • 110 min.
    Meet Abdul Samee: his father is Iraqi, and his mother is Puerto Rican—but if you ask him, he’ll say he’s Italian. Longing to shed his cultural identity, he changes his name to Sam, marries an American and does everything in his power to turn his back on his heritage. But when Sam meets Yasmina, a beautiful woman from his father’s homeland, he begins to learn that a tree without roots cannot stand for long. Learn More

  9. Lasso of Truth

    Lasso of Truth

    By Carson Kreitzer.

    Product Code: LM4000

    • Comedy | Drama
    • College | Community | Professional
    • 2m., 3w.
    • 120 min.

    Who is Wonder Woman and where did she come from? Lasso of Truth explores the knotty origin story of our preeminent female superhero, created by William Marston, inventor of the first lie-detector machine. This smart, seductive, wild ride features the two women Marston lived with in a polyamorous relationship—both of whom inspired the famous character—plus a girl in search of answers about her childhood heroine and a guy trying to hold on to his prized first issue.
